Episodes

Matthew 11-12: Jesus Gets Mad at Church (And So Can You!) 06.07.2026

As word of his works spreads, Jesus isn't too happy with how the church is responding. Dan and Justin get into Jesus's ego, the definition of blasphemy, and how churches have misconstrued the intent of these verses.

Matthew 8-10: Not My Bacon, Not My Circus 29.06.2026

The story of Jesus's miracles are some of the best known in the Bible. Dan and Justin discuss why they're included, how they're organized, and whether Jesus really needed to send demons into pigs.

Matthew 5-7: Jesus's Eras Tour 22.06.2026

This week, we head to the Sermon on the Mount, where Jesus plays the greatest hits. Dan and Justin discuss the direct quotations of Jesus and how the Beatitudes are often misinterpreted.

Matthew 1-4: New Skywalker, Who This? 22.06.2026

Dan and Justin open the podcast with a brief overview of the New Testament, why we don't know much about Teen Jesus, and what Jesus was up to for those forty days in the desert.
